Overview

A beautifully situated property with a panoramic pool, extensive views over the Sicilian heartland and proximity to some of the most fascinating villages in Sicily. Principato is a well designed villa, perfect for a family holiday "away from it all" or as a base for exploring the Madonie mountains, on foot, by car or by bike. Large, shady terraces and a well organised open-plan indoor living area make this an ideal house for both the height of summer and the lower seasons.

The Area

Principato is in the Madonie mountains, near to the small hamlet of Raffo, and just a few minutes drive from the beautiful towns of Petralia Soprana and Petralia Sottana (upper and lower) with their abundance of fabulous churches, unspoiled squares and stunning views. These are villages where one has the feeling that time has stood still for the past fifty years. The more modern town of Madonuzza is about 2km from the house, and offers a good choice of shops. The Madonie mountains offer some of the finest walking in Sicily, with the peak of Pizzo Carbonara, at just under 2,000m, boasting views as far as Palermo to the west and Etna to the east. Finally, the sandy beaches at Lascari are just 60 minutes drive away.
